City Guide
Northampton County, Pennsylvania, United States
Overview
Northampton County, Pennsylvania combines historic charm with modern convenience, featuring lively downtowns, picturesque suburban landscapes, and a strong community spirit. The area offers cultural attractions, outdoor recreation, and easy access to New York City and Philadelphia.
Best Time to Visit
April to June or September to October for pleasant weather and seasonal festivals.
Local Tips
Parking downtown can be limited during events; use public lots or walk. Lehigh Valley International Airport is nearby for flights, and the county is well connected by highways.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is expected in restaurants (15-20%). Dress is casual but neat, especially when visiting historic venues. Locals are friendly, but respect private property and quiet hours.
Safety Warnings
Downtown areas are generally safe, but use caution late at night around isolated bus stops. Some riverfront paths may be poorly lit; avoid walking alone after dark. Watch for high traffic near large events.
Hidden Gems
Explore the Moravian Museum in Bethlehem, the Karl Stirner Arts Trail in Easton, Jacobsburg State Park for hiking, and the Martin Guitar Factory in Nazareth for a unique tour.
